Art, in all of its forms, is ripe with the opportunity for self expression, and in this workshop we will create personalized bags that allow you to take that self expression with you everywhere you go. We are going to spend the day learning simple techniques for creating beautiful portraits even if you have never drawn before. We will discuss proportion, placement, and color while we explore the beauty of the human face in the morning. In the afternoon, we put it all together while we make our own "bag ladies", complete with ribbons, charms, and embellishments to reflect your personal style.
